Most GErrors, such as GSomethingError, have a function to get
their quark that looks like g_something_error_quark(),
so bindings (such as gtkmm) would expect GVariantParseError
to have g_variant_parse_error_quark(). Instead this had
g_variant_parser_get_error_quark().
This deprecates the old function and adds the correct one,
making life easier for gtkmm (and maybe others).
